The Manager, Art Direction is responsible for the guidance of creative associates across all channels. These responsibilities include creating and communicating concepts, implementing promotional/marketing strategies and developing creative solutions. The Manager, Art Direction will work with and provide guidance to the creative team including art direction, designers, copywriters and other production specialists. Balancing creative thinking with solid leadership skills, this associate will work with the team to successfully translate concepts to visual expression.
Key Responsibilities:
- 30% Continuous Improvement – Help establish art direction standards for creative production; Improves art direction and creative quality by studying, evaluating and improving creative methods used; Support dissemination of final creative assets to capture best practices and share across creative organization; Maintain stewardship of The Home Depot brand image, tone and feel. Collaborate with designers and other team members to share best practices and ensure consistency in creative execution
- 50% Creative Excellence and Execution – Drive creative excellence, best practices and consistent creative execution across all channels; Provide a high level of conceptual thinking with the ability to understand how copy and art work within a concept; Ensure story lines are aligned with creative concepts and THD brand standards; Attend and support production shoot logistics, review shooting boards to ensure necessary content is captured and approved as made real time; Provide creative oversight and input (on creative treatments) for creative assets, both internally-produced and agency-produced; Manage communications and updates to creative leadership as well as stakeholders; Oversee quality assurance of creative deliverables, from both internal teams and partner agencies, to ensure designs align with strategy and adhere to brand, channel and platform guidelines
- 10% Leadership – Mentor and coach team members through project development and performance management
- 10% Relationship Building – Support and maintain relationships by communicating updates across pods and production teams and help prepare materials for updates; Identify and partner with Campaign Activation Management team and Operations on opportunities for improvements in creative process, timelines, approvals, etc
